Network technology giant Juniper warns users about denial-of-service bugs
Aug. 30, 2023, 7 p.m. |
The Record by Recorded Future therecord.media
Juniper Networks, which makes popular networking equipment and security technology, is warning about flaws in the operating systems for many of those products.
